"Shgandy" wrote:

I am using IE7 with Vista Ultimate, when want to export some data from a IE7
window by using the "export to microsoft excel " all that happens is the
window blinks and nothing else happens. I believe it is a security setting in
IE7 but which one i don't know. Could someone please offer some assistance.
